The clear class act dropping from the highest Sheffield grades into OR3 company. Won at A2 level over 500 metres here from trap six with an outstanding 90-rated performance in 28.93 seconds, then followed up with a second at A1 posting 72 and a third at A1 posting 71 — that is top-grade Sheffield form that towers over this OR3 field. The career average of 68 is the best here and the form trajectory from oldest to newest — 66, 40, 67, 90, 72, 71 — shows a dog performing consistently in the seventies at the highest level after a blip of 40 that now looks an anomaly. The Fader profile with high early pace of 84 is well suited to the tight 480-metre layout where front runners prosper. Trap six at Sheffield 480m carries a strong 23.5 percent win rate, making this the second-best draw after trap one. The one question is the step down from 500 to 480 metres — zero distance suitability at this trip — but the class difference between A1 and OR3 is enormous and should more than compensate.
